Batting 1000 recently. Another Jinhao pen, the 9009...another winner...five bucks. I ordered a hooded version of the pen (fine nib) but was sent a non-hooded version (medium nib) by mistake. At first I was PO’d but went ahead and flushed it with water and Dawn dish soap, followed by a thorough clear water rinse and paper towel dry. Filled the little beauty (which is a Claret color) with my favorite red ink...Diamine Red Dragon. Boy howdy, does the pen write well...a nice easy medium line that’s just the ideal wetness. The nib is very smooth with no scratchiness in any direction...so the tines are aligned properly. Just excellent. Very pleased.
